Old Fashion Dolls Are Lovly Dolls
Helpful Votes: 25 out of 26 total.
Review Date: 1999-05-09
This book has simple straight forward instructions. The doll pattern is simple as are the clothes. This book is for the dollmaker who wants a doll that is beautifully old fashion, but doesn't have the time to search for an original vintage doll. The doll is approximatly 18" tall with a wardrobe that contains nightgowns, dresses, pinafores,overskirts, bonnets,a suit,wedding dress and cape with muffs. She even has her own dolly!

Great looking dolls and dresses
Helpful Votes: 9 out of 9 total.
Review Date: 2006-06-17
This is a beautiful book with beautiful dolls and great clothes patterns. It's a great gift to give a little girl her own doll with its own wardrobe. You could do the doll to look like the little girl and the dresses in her favorite colors. There is even a prarie wedding dress. The only thing that I didn't like was the suggestion to varnish the head, neck and hands to make the dolls look antique. This would make the dolls faces hard. I would prefer to leave the dolls natural, or if you really want to antique them, use a gel stain or tea dye to get the same effect without the stiffness.

Failed to meet expectations
Helpful Votes: 0 out of 2 total.
Review Date: 2003-05-28
This book has a good story and an interesting angle. I liked the involvement of the Indian characters, although the Indian aspects of the story were very superficial. It is a fun read, although lacking in any real depth. The characters are all very one-dimentional. Changes in attitude are sudden and un-supported by the story.

I found the writing style to be rather annoying. The verb tense switches repeatedly from past to present tense and back again. Sometimes in the same paragraph. It feels very sloppy.

In general, the book reads like a pre-teen chapter book, although the subject matter (government conspiracies and assasination plots) would preclude that particular audience. It's a shame, because this could have been a really terrific story.

A dream combination of three fine authors
Helpful Votes: 9 out of 10 total.
Review Date: 2006-03-28
Niobia Bryant, Melanie Schuster and Kimberley White join forces to create a wonderfully engaging anthology that focuses on finding love using unconventional, but increasingly popular, methods.

A consistently brilliant writer, Niobia Bryant excels again with "Could It Be" the story of Ameena and Marcus. Ameena is a fashion stylist to the stars who has made a good life for herself, but in the process has sacrificed meeting the man of her dreams. When one of her girlfriends invites her to go along for a night of speed dating, Ameena decides to give it a shot. During a night of meeting less than stellar men, she comes across Marcus and is quickly infatuated. Marcus has also been dragged along to the speed dating event by friends and never expected to meet someone like Ameena. They quickly fall into a romantic relationship, but will face tests that cause them to question whether their connection is real.

Melanie Schuster, another sure bet for a great story and widely known for her novels on the Cochran/Devereaux clan, introduces new characters in her contribution "Chain Of Fools". This story centers on Liz, an executive producer, who is talked into appearing on a reality dating show by her good friend and boss. Liz decides to prove her point that all men are only interested in surface characteristics by dressing up as a hoochie to appear on the show. However, the joke is on her when she meets the man of her dreams Romare under these false pretenses. Romare has been coerced to go on the show in a bet with his brothers and cousin. He doesn't expect to be taken with the type of woman who would participate in such a show, but quickly falls under Liz's spell. The story plays out in an interesting fashion as Liz tries to figure out how to recover from the mess she has gotten herself into; while Romare struggles with being attracted to a woman he never thought would have a chance to get to him. Melanie's story is wonderful and I hope we will see some of the supporting cast members in stories of their own.

In "To Have It All" Kimberley White ends the anthology with a nice contribution of her own. Screenwriter Lacey has made it big after one of her scripts has been made in to a blockbuster movie. The price of succeeding, however, has been the lack of time or opportunity to cultivate a romantic relationship. After being teased and taunted by her best friend about her lack of a romantic life, Lacey signs up for an online matching service. Her first encounter is with "Chococate Dream", also known as agent/attorney Mikel. Through in depth conversations online, they quickly become completely infatuated with each other. Their story, though brief, is fulfilling with both romantic elements and dramatic elements brought through the interactions of the main characters with friends and acquaintances.

This was a wonderful anthology that paired three great writers to form a cohesive, satisfying mix of three strong stories.

101 Linebacker Drills
Helpful Votes: 12 out of 12 total.
Review Date: 2000-06-04
The book is great if your a football coach. It's full of useful drills. However, If your looking for techniques or info on how to be a better Linebacker this is not the book. A better book would be Lou Tepper's "Complete Linebacking". 101 Linebacking Drills is not a bad book, but it's purpose focuses on drills only.

A very good introduction and view into the Fashion Business
Helpful Votes: 126 out of 134 total.
Review Date: 1999-06-15
I not only learned alot from reading this book but actually enjoyed the reading considering it's a text book. As someone who's trying to get back into the fashion industry after a 20 year hiatus; I feel that I have the knowledge I need to head in the direction I want to go now. I really liked how they used real companies for examples and at the end of each chapter they have an explanation of a job in the industry with comments from people in those jobs. There's lots of charts, lists of important contacts, calendars of events, etc that will be important to anyone starting a fashion business or wanting to find a job in fashion. It's worth the money if you can't afford to go to school for this.
